What Is DS18B20 and How Does It Work?
The DS18B20 is a low-cost digital temperature sensor that uses a unique 1-Wire communication protocol, requiring only one data pin to connect to most microcontrollers. In practice, this cuts down wiring complexity for multi-sensor projects significantly.
Q: What temperature range can DS18B20 measure?
A: Industry consensus confirms that the standard DS18B20 supports temperature measurement from -55°C to +125°C. Actual batch tests from JYX Sensor show calibrated sensors maintain a stable ±0.5°C accuracy across 90% of this range, which meets most application requirements.

Step-by-Step Wiring Guide for DS18B20
Wiring a DS18B20 to a common microcontroller like Arduino or ESP32 only takes 4 simple steps, as shown below:
- Connect the DS18B20 VDD pin to your microcontroller’s 3.3V or 5V output, matching your board’s power specification
- Link the DS18B20 GND pin to your microcontroller’s common ground to complete the power circuit
- Connect the DS18B20 data pin to your microcontroller’s digital input, then add a 4.7kΩ pull-up resistor between the VDD and data pin
- Install the OneWire library to your microcontroller, upload the test code and start reading temperature data
Comparison of Common DS18B20 Packages
DS18B20 sensors come in two main package types for different use cases. The table below compares their core features based on 2026 product data from JYX Sensor:
| Comparison Dimension | TO-92 Bare DS18B20 | Waterproof Probe DS18B20 |
|---|---|---|
| Suitable Environment | Dry, enclosed PCB space | Outdoor, liquid, high humidity environments |
| Base Accuracy | ±0.5°C | ±0.5°C (same core IC) |
| Customization Options | No extended cable | 1m, 2m, 3m, 5m custom cable lengths available |
| Average Unit Price (Bulk) | $0.35 - $0.50 | $0.8 - $2.2 depending on cable length |

Q: What is the typical accuracy of a DS18B20?
A: Most standard DS18B20 sensors have an accuracy of ±0.5°C between -10°C and +85°C, which meets the demand of most hobbyist, commercial and light industrial projects. Calibrated high-precision options can reach ±0.2°C accuracy for specific use cases.
Q: Can DS18B20 work with Raspberry Pi or ESP32?
A: Yes, DS18B20 is compatible with all common mainstream microcontrollers and single-board computers including Arduino, ESP32, and Raspberry Pi, with mature open source libraries available for fast integration.
Q: Can I use non-waterproof DS18B20 in water?
A: No, standard TO-92 encapsulated DS18B20 is not waterproof. Exposure to water or high humidity will damage the sensor core. You should always use a waterproof probe DS18B20 for liquid or outdoor wet environment applications.
